Kinds Of Coffee Makers

When browsing for a cheap coffee machine in the UK, it's vital to comprehend the different types readily available:

TypeDescriptionRate RangeDrip Coffee MakersBrew coffee by dripping boiling water through grounds₤ 20 - ₤ 100French PressA manual approach where ground coffee is soaked in hot water and pressed₤ 10 - ₤ 30Espresso MachinesHigh-pressure machines that create espresso shots₤ 30 - ₤ 300Single-Serve Pod MachinesUsage pre-packaged coffee pods for benefit₤ 30 - ₤ 100PercolatorsBrew coffee by biking boiling water through the grounds repeatedly₤ 20 - ₤ 60Cold Brew MakersCreated particularly for developing coffee with cold water₤ 15 - ₤ 40

Top Features to Consider

When looking for an affordable coffee maker, consider the following features:

  1. Capacity: Determine the number of cups you typically brew in one session.
  2. Relieve of Use: Look for designs that are basic to run, specifically for novice users.
  3. Cleaning and Maintenance: Check if the coffee maker is easy to tidy and maintain, as this can impact long-lasting use.
  4. Sturdiness: Invest in a design known for its durability to prevent frequent replacements.
  5. Extra Functions: Some coffee makers include features like programmable settings, integrated grinders, or thermal carafes.
Where to Buy Cheap Coffee Makers in the UK

Finding an economical coffee maker is easier than ever with different shopping options readily available:

  • Online Retailers: Websites such as Amazon, eBay, and Currys PC World often feature sales and discounts on coffee makers.
  • High Street Stores: Retailers like Argos, John Lewis, and Tesco supply a selection of coffee machine at multiple rate points.
  • Discount Stores: Shops like B&M, Lidl, or Aldi may provide affordable appliances from time to time.
  • Second-Hand Options: Consider examining local classifieds or charity shops for secondhand designs at a fraction of the expense.

Care and Maintenance Tips

To make sure that a cheap coffee machine lasts as long as possible, think about the following upkeep suggestions:

  • Regular Cleaning: Clean the coffee maker after each use to prevent residue accumulation.
  • Descaling: Use a descaling service a minimum of once a month to prevent mineral buildup.
  • Store Properly: When not in use, save the coffee maker in a dry location to secure its parts.
  • Consult Manufacturer Guidelines: Always refer to the user manual for specific care guidelines customized to your model.
